Dark Chocolate Market - Report Scope:
The dark chocolate market encompasses a wide array of products made from cocoa solids, cocoa butter, and sugar, with minimal to no milk solids. Known for its rich flavor and health benefits, dark chocolate has gained substantial popularity across the globe. Increasing consumer awareness regarding the antioxidant properties of dark chocolate, along with its role in promoting heart health and reducing stress, is contributing to its growing demand. Furthermore, innovation in product formulations and the expansion of premium and organic chocolate lines are influencing market dynamics.
Market Growth Drivers:
The global dark chocolate market is witnessing robust growth due to several key factors. Rising consumer awareness about the health benefits associated with dark chocolate, including its high antioxidant content and potential to lower blood pressure, is significantly boosting consumption. The increasing preference for low-sugar and high-cocoa-content products among health-conscious individuals is driving demand across both developed and developing economies. Additionally, the premiumization trend in the chocolate industry and the growing popularity of organic and sustainably sourced cocoa are further propelling market expansion. The integration of dark chocolate in various food and beverage applications such as bakery, dairy, and confectionery items is also enhancing its market reach.
Market Restraints:
Despite strong market potential, the dark chocolate segment faces notable challenges. One of the primary restraints is the high cost of production, particularly due to the use of premium cocoa and sustainable sourcing practices. This often leads to elevated retail prices, which may deter price-sensitive consumers, especially in emerging markets. In addition, fluctuating raw material prices, particularly cocoa, can impact profit margins and product pricing stability. The bitter taste profile of high-cocoa dark chocolate also limits its appeal among certain consumer segments, particularly children and individuals with a preference for sweeter flavors.
Market Opportunities:
The dark chocolate market presents a variety of growth opportunities, particularly through product innovation and expanding consumer bases. Manufacturers are increasingly focusing on functional and fortified dark chocolates infused with ingredients such as nuts, fruits, probiotics, and superfoods to cater to health-oriented consumers. There is also substantial growth potential in the personal care and cosmetics segment, where dark chocolate extracts are used for their antioxidant properties. Furthermore, increasing penetration of e-commerce platforms and digital marketing strategies are helping brands reach a broader audience and boost sales. The rising demand for vegan, gluten-free, and ethically produced chocolates in regions such as North America and Europe creates avenues for new product launches and strategic collaborations.

Competitive Intelligence and Business Strategy:
Leading companies in the global dark chocolate market, such as Mars Inc., Mondelez International, Ferrero, Nestle S.A., The Hershey Company, Lindt & Sprungli AG, and Barry Callebaut, are heavily investing in premium product development and sustainable sourcing practices to capture consumer interest. These companies are leveraging strategies like organic certifications, fair-trade sourcing, and sugar-free formulations to differentiate themselves in a competitive market. Collaborations with local distributors, focus on eco-friendly packaging, and investments in e-commerce capabilities are strengthening market presence and distribution networks. Innovations such as bean-to-bar concepts and experiential retail formats are also contributing to brand loyalty and market expansion.
